Essex County Heating Oil Trends
Last year, Essex County homeowners purchased a total of 59 million gallons of heating oil.
Short Term Trends
Essex’s overall fuel oil use changes from year to year primarily depending on how cold each winter is. As the temperature outside gets more chilly, homes’ boilers need to burn increasing amounts of number two heating oil to maintain a constant interior temperature. Last winter, the average outside temperature in Essex was 29.9°F, which was 0.6°F warmer than the prior winter's average outside temperature.

Essex County Homeowner’s Guide to Selecting an Oil Company
For Essex residences heating with oil, choosing which of the 176 heating oil companies that serve Essex is an important decision.
Full Service Oil Companies: Homeowners who prefer a “set-it-and-forget-it” heating system choose one of the 1239 “full-service” oil companies that serve Essex. Full service companies such as Keohan Fuels & Transportation Inc or Absolute Oil offer households annual contracts which consist of a combined package of both automatic number two heating oil delivery and boiler repair. With an automatic heating oil delivery contract, the company tracks your home’s fuel oil consumption and makes deliveries when your tank is running low. The family does not need to monitor the level of the oil tank or place individual orders.
Discount Oil Companies: also referred to as “COD Fuel” or “Cash Heating Oil” companies, discount oil companies are for households who are looking to save money. With discount oil companies, in return for better prices, you monitor the oil level in your tank, and you place an oil order when you're running low. Oil delivery has two parts to it: First, an oil truck picks up oil at the nearest bulk fuel terminal (also known as a “rack”). In the case of Essex, two of the closest terminals are Sprague W in Springfield, MA and Buckeye in Springfield, MA. Then, the truck delivers the number two heating oil to homes and businesses throughout Essex and the surrounding area.
